Output eab8a865c4545e8507e4e160324bab70bed9c7f438ff0cc7364d4802c317110e:5

value
58604
script pubkey
OP_0 OP_PUSHBYTES_20 3dd472dea3388817a48fb70173ebff4ab8d94d06
address
bc1q8h289h4r8zyp0fy0kuqh86llf2udjngxpx0auy
transaction
eab8a865c4545e8507e4e160324bab70bed9c7f438ff0cc7364d4802c317110e
confirmations
152923
spent
true